Bitmine Adds $220M in ETH, Total Now $6.6B

Bitmine boosts its ETH stash with a $220M buy, now holding 1.57M ETH worth $6.6B.

  • Bitmine adds 52,475 ETH worth $220M
  • Total ETH holdings rise to 1.57 million ETH
  • Holdings now valued at approximately $6.6 billion

Bitmine is making waves in the crypto space with another massive Ethereum acquisition. The crypto investment giant just purchased 52,475 ETH for approximately $220 million, according to on-chain data. This latest move adds even more weight to Bitmine’s growing Ethereum portfolio, signaling a firm bullish stance on the asset.

This isn’t Bitmine’s first large-scale ETH buy. With this recent purchase, the company now holds a staggering 1,575,848 ETH, which is currently valued at around $6.6 billion.
